데이터베이스에 LINQ 쿼리를 수행하는 여러 가지 메서드로 구성된 DAL이 있습니다.지연된 방식이 아닌 내 DAL에서 내 LINQ 쿼리를 실행할 수 있도록하려면 어떻게해야합니까?
반환하기 전에 IEnumberable 또는 유사한 것을 데이터베이스에서 실행하기 전에 결과가 사용될 때만 지연된 방식으로 실행되는 것이 아니라 이라는 LOOQ 쿼리가 실행되는지 확인해야합니다.
내가 호출 할 수 있음을 알고 있습니다. 내 메서드에서 강제로 내 결과에 내 결과를, 그러나 이것이 최선의 방법입니까?
왜 지연 실행을 원하십니까? – Kev